Rock the Baggy Denim Trend: Top Wide-Leg Jeans Revealed

By Matthew Lynch
November 24, 2024
0
Spread the love

The baggy denim trend is in full swing, offering a comfortable and stylish alternative to skinny jeans. Here’s a roundup of the best wide-leg jeans to help you rock this look:

  1. Levi’s High Loose Jeans – Perfect for achieving that vintage-inspired look with modern comfort.
  2. Everlane The Way-High Baggy Jean – Sustainably made with a super high rise for a flattering silhouette.
  3. Madewell The Perfect Vintage Wide-Leg Jean – Offers a subtle flare and comes in various washes.
  4. AGOLDE Baggy Oversized Jean – For those who want to go all-in on the baggy trend.
  5. Reformation Cynthia High Rise Straight Long Jeans – Ideal for taller individuals looking for extra length.
  6. Zara Wide Leg Full Length Jeans – An affordable option that doesn’t compromise on style.
  7. Citizens of Humanity Annina Trouser Jean – Combines the comfort of jeans with the polish of trousers.
  8. Uniqlo U Wide Fit Curved Jeans – Offers a unique curved leg design for added interest.
  9. Boyish The Ziggy High-Waisted Wide-Leg Jean – Eco-friendly option with a vintage-inspired wash.
  10. Gap High Rise Barrel Jeans – Features a trendy barrel leg shape that’s both comfortable and stylish.

When styling wide-leg jeans, balance is key. Pair them with fitted tops or cropped jackets to create a proportional silhouette. Don’t forget to experiment with different shoe choices – from sneakers to heels – to change up the look for various occasions.
